Balance and Flow
Use the A-line dress trick to create an effortlessly cool style, pairing a shift or fit-and-flare design that hits just above the knee, showcasing your legs. Perfect for curvy figures, this silhouette creates a balanced look that skims rather than clings.
Consider a long-sleeved dress in a lightweight, breathable cotton fabric like voile, which adds a soft, romantic touch. Cream or pale blue are great options for creating a sunny summer look that flatters a pear-shaped body.
Jean Harlow-inspired Hollywood glamour is easy to achieve with a halter-neck silk dress that cinches at the waist, creating a dramatic curve. Plus, a more severe neckline draws the eye upwards and elongates the neck. Add a statement piece of vintage-inspired jewelry to complete the look.
Statement Sleeves and Softer Silhouettes
Soft, relaxed-fit tops are a must-have for creating a plus-size friendly wardrobe. Pair a comfortable A-line or dropped shoulder tee with distressed denim jeans featuring embroidered details for a casual yet put-together look.
Statement sleeves can add a whimsical touch to any outfit. Opt for a sassy bell or puffy sleeve in a lightweight knit fabric like merino wool, and balance the look with a flowy maxi skirt in a rich jewel tone.
For a fashion-forward look, combine a loose-fitting cable-knit sweater with streamlined trousers in a neutral shade, like charcoal grey. This versatile combination pairs beautifully with nearly any color, making it an ideal choice for a wardrobe staple.
Flattering Fabrics and Colors
For every body type, certain fabrics tend to flatter more than others. Opt for stretchy jersey dresses and tops that cling to the body, skimming over lumps and bumps. The added benefit of these fabrics is that they also provide comfort and flexibility.
Soft, breathable fabrics like silk and cotton also work wonders for creating a smooth, streamlined silhouette. Look for a flowy maxi dress in a lightweight cotton lawn featuring a subtle floral pattern for a simply elegant spring look that flatters any figure.
For a chic, high-fashion-inspired look, don’t be afraid to mix and match bold colors and patterns. A statement red skirt with a crisp white blouse and matching red pumps is always a winning combination.
